目的 探讨移居高原早期血液中性粒细胞的线粒体形态学变化.方法 分别在海拔1400 m某地选取3名拟乘汽车进入海拔4200 m高原的健康男性青年,采集空腹静脉血5 ml(0 d),分离白细胞,戊二醛固定,采用透射电镜观察其中性粒细胞中的线粒体形态学变化.跟踪该3人到达4200 m高原,分别在到达高原后7、30 d时再观察上述指标.同时选取职业、年龄相匹配的3名从平原移居4200 m 高原1年的健康男性,测定其上述指标.结果 移居高原7 d时,线粒体核周间隙增宽,不均匀,线粒体数量较多,较多线粒体出现固缩、水肿等;移居高原30 d时,大量线粒体固缩,核周间隙扩张;移居高原1年时,线粒体数目较多,形态逐渐恢复正常,仅个别线粒体出现水肿.结论 移居高原早期线粒体的形态发生改变,但随着时间推移,线粒体的形态逐渐正常.%Objective To investigate the early morphologic changes of netrophil mitochondria in healthy young men after immigration into high altitude. Methods Three young men lived in 1400 m altitude who would arrive in a plateau of 4200 m altitude by automobile were enrolled in this study. Their fasting venous blood of 5 ml was collected on day 0, and then white blood cells were isolated and fixed by glutaraldehyde for the observation of morphologic changes of neutrophil mitochondria under transmission electron microscope. After these three men arrived at 4200 m altitude for 7 d and 30 d,the above morphologic indexes of their mitochondria was respectively observed. Meanwhile, the same morphologic indexes of other three young men who had migrated to 4200 m altitude for one year from the plain with matched occupation and age were observed as controls. Results On day 7 after migrating at high altitude,the perinuclear space of mitochondria became widened and uneven. There were many mitochondria in neutrophils and most of them were pyknotic and edematus. On day 30,a large number of pyknotic mitochondria were seen with expanded perinuclear space. One year after migration,most appearances of mitochondria had already recovered to normal, but less of them still showed edema. Conclusion Morphologic changes of neutrophil mitochondria can be found early after high - altitude migration. However, its appearance gradually becomes normal with the acclimatization to high altitude environment.
